Aims and Fit of Module

This module is designed to combine the theories and methodologies of risk modelling with the complex needs of effectively managing risks in practice.
This module also provides a solid theoretical foundation of risk management by introducing risk management models to measure and manage various types of risks through applications, with the emphasis on the implementation of risk models in practice.
This module prepares students to the practical challenges of risk in a professional environment.

Learning outcomes

A	Explain and apply fundamental theories, principles and models in modern financial risk management.
B	Analyse volatility, dependence and extreme-value behaviour, and evaluate their significance in the measurement and management of financial risk.
C	Apply a range of quantitative risk measures and modelling approaches to assess different forms of financial risk exposure.
D	Identify, distinguish and critically interpret major sources of market- and business-relevant risk, including market, portfolio, counterparty credit, liquidity and operational risk.
E	Use programming, software and AI-supported methods for risk analysis, critically evaluating, verifying, adapting and appropriately declaring AI-assisted outputs.

Method of teaching and learning

This module will be delivered by a combination of formal lectures, tutorials and computer labs.
